TTの話。Catalyst にて。あるところは 'foo/wrapper.tt'、あるところは 'bar/wrapper.tt' を使いたい 思いついた方法 1. むりやり $c->view('TT')->template->service->{WRAPPER} = [ 'foo/wrapper.tt' ]; なんかヤ いろいろワナ有 2. WRAPPER文に変数 wapperされるほうのテンプレート [% WRAPPER $wapper%] ... [% END # WRAPPER %]で、 $c->stash->{wrapper} = 'foo/wrapper.tt'; WRAPPER文(特にEND)がめんどい 3. PROCESS文に変数 configでオートラッパーを xxx/wrapper.tt とかにして、それにはただ [% PROCESS $wrapper -%]と書き、 $